I really need help in what to do about landlord for my HUD supported apartment. We have been getting very sick, I kept smelling a overpower smell of mold, told landlord. It is so bad and not safe. The landlord never came so I paid $500 for before to find the problem, they found serious water leak under house. There was a pond of constant water and said there is a serious constant leaking problem and would damage and told us this is a hazard and to get out but we have no $ to do so.
It’s been 2 months and still nobody to fix the safety issues. I called health and sanitation department and he said it don't look good and called landlord and said needs to be fixed along with the backed up sewer with fecal and toilet paper that my 6 year old grandson was playing in, that how I found that. Been 2 months and no word. I been deathly sick and had to have CAT scan, they found a tumor in my lung that could possibly be mold, fungus bacterial. I have to have biopsy. We have headaches, bloody noses, and fever, too much to list.
My doctor wrote letter to HUD and said I’m severely suffering from mold toxify and need to move now. Well, my caseworker was very mean to me and said she needs proof there is mold, even though I had before "the biggest construction comp in the world" wrote a letter saying from his readings and the pond of water under home said as long as this has been leaking there very well could be alot of toxins from this but he said they need to take to lab to test but I can't afford that.
It’s so obvious how bad this is and he was in home for 15 minutes and hit him on not feeling well. I can't believe the landlord don’t want to fix his rental so he can continue to lease in the HUD program. We have done EVERYTHING we were asked to do plus some but nobody wants to do what is just right. This killed my Siamese and my dog is very sick with a severe cough, the vet said the reason my cat pulled his hair out till he bled was due to a very toxic allergy. I’m very scared and frustrated that this landlord and HUD are just leaving us here to die and are treating us badly because we had to complain. I don't get how people can be so uncaring. I wish they would come sit in the home for 15 minutes and see how they feel. Please somebody help me find a safe place to live or fix this apartment, I have 3 beautiful children and grandbabies I want to see grow up, the thought of moving sounds horrific because I’m so weak and sicker from this mold. I been running fevers everyday now for month. Thank you so much for reading this and hope I hear back from someone soon, have a great day and that you kindly:
